In 2025, Facebook Marketplace often hides seller contact details or addresses for privacy reasons. However, if you're trying to view hidden information ethically, here are a few tips:
Message the Seller Directly – Politely ask for the info you need (like address, phone, or more images).
Check Listing Details – Some info is hidden until you click “Ask for details” or similar options.
View on Desktop – Sometimes more data is visible on the web version compared to the app.
Join Relevant Groups – Many sellers repost in public groups where more info may be available.
Always respect privacy policies and avoid using third-party tools that violate terms of service.
